Four firefighters were hurt Friday battling a brush fire in Coto de Caza and briefly threatened some homes before crews got the upper hand.
None of the firefighter injuries sustained life-threatening injuries, according to the Orange County Fire Authority, which reported that the blaze blackened 20 acres.
OCFA Capt. Larry Kurtz said the fire, which was reported at 11:22 a.m. at 17 Tortoise Shell, initially threatened some houses. The cause of the blaze, which was contained by 2:15 p.m., was under investigation, but it’s not considered suspicious, he said.
About 70 firefighters attacked the flames from the air and on ground, Kurtz said.
